From 260010c175ab17faccc970040802f07e5b079781 Mon Sep 17 00:00:00 2001 From: Mishio595 Date: Sun, 16 Sep 2018 11:50:17 -0600 Subject: Finish rebase --- src/framework/standard/mod.rs | 9 +-------- 1 file changed, 1 insertion(+), 8 deletions(-) (limited to 'src/framework') diff --git a/src/framework/standard/mod.rs b/src/framework/standard/mod.rs index 8c2fcd6..aa32d11 100644 --- a/src/framework/standard/mod.rs +++ b/src/framework/standard/mod.rs @@ -1053,7 +1053,7 @@ impl Framework for StandardFramework { // we want to make sure that all following matching prefixes are longer // than the last matching one, this prevents picking a wrong prefix, // e.g. "f" instead of "ferris" due to "f" having a lower index in the `Vec`. - let longest_matching_prefix_len = prefixes.iter().fold(0, |longest_prefix_len, prefix| + longest_matching_prefix_len = prefixes.iter().fold(0, |longest_prefix_len, prefix| if prefix.len() > longest_prefix_len && built.starts_with(prefix) && (orginal_round.len() == prefix.len() || built.get(prefix.len()..prefix.len() + 1) == Some(" ")) { @@ -1112,13 +1112,6 @@ impl Framework for StandardFramework { let command = Arc::clone(command); let mut args = command_and_help_args!(&message.content, position, command_length, &self.configuration.delimiters); - let mut args = { - let content = message.content.chars().skip(position).skip_while(|x| x.is_whitespace()) - .skip(command_length).collect::(); - - Args::new(&content.trim(), &self.configuration.delimiters) - }; - if let Some(error) = self.should_fail( &mut context, &message, -- cgit v1.2.3